Summary
The Serious Incident Response Team (SiRT) is investigating a serious injury sustained by an adult woman while in custody of the Edmundston Police Force (EPF) in Edmundston, New Brunswick.
Preliminary information suggests:
- On the night of February 19, 2026, members of the EPF responded to a disturbance at a local hotel.
- An adult woman was located at the bar and arrested under the Intoxicated Persons Detention Act. The officers placed her in handcuffs and transported her to the police station.
- In the early morning hours of February 20, 2026, an ambulance was called to assess the woman in cells as she complained of pain in her arm but they were unable to assess her.
- The woman went to the hospital after she was released from custody, where she was diagnosed with a fracture to her arm.
